4.1 Non-Duality (Advaita Vedanta)
Yoga Vasistha deeply explores Advaita Vedanta, emphasizing non-duality as the ultimate reality. It teaches that the universe and the self are one, dispelling illusions of separation. This philosophy guides seekers to realize their true nature, achieving liberation through self-inquiry and understanding the illusory nature of the world.
4.2 The Nature of Reality and Existence
Yoga Vasistha expounds that reality is an illusion (Maya), with the world perceived as transient and unreal. It emphasizes that consciousness is the ultimate reality, advocating detachment from worldly attachments to attain liberation. This teaching aligns with Advaita Vedanta, guiding seekers to comprehend the true nature of existence and achieve spiritual freedom.
4.3 The Role of Mind in Spiritual Growth
The Yoga Vasistha underscores the mind’s dual role as both a binding and liberating force. It teaches that the mind creates illusions, yet, when controlled, it becomes a tool for self-realization. By understanding the mind’s transient nature and cultivating awareness, one can transcend mental bondage and achieve spiritual liberation.

9.2 Features of Gita Press Editions
Gita Press editions of Yoga Vasistha are renowned for their clarity and authenticity. They include the original Sanskrit text, precise Hindi translations, and detailed commentaries, making the complex philosophy accessible. The editions are printed on high-quality paper, ensuring durability, and are affordably priced to reach a wide audience.
